This spray device is constructed from AISI 316L stainless steel, which offers excellent corrosion resistance and meets food-grade sanitation standards for beverage production environments.
The device features a mounting flange for secure installation and connects directly to CIP/SIP system piping. It delivers precise spray patterns to thoroughly clean and sanitize interior surfaces of tanks, vessels, and processing equipment.
Regular inspection of the spray nozzle/head for clogging, checking mounting flange seals, and verifying spray pattern effectiveness are recommended. The 316L stainless steel construction minimizes corrosion but should be inspected during routine CIP/SIP system maintenance.
